3. Why we process personal data

We process personal data for the following purposes and on the corresponding GDPR legal bases:

Purpose Legal basis
Processing purchases, payments, delivery, personalisation, returns and order-related support Performance of a contract or steps requested before entering into a contract — Article 6(1)(b) GDPR
Providing an optional customer account at your request Performance of a contract — Article 6(1)(b) GDPR
Meeting tax, accounting and applicable consumer-law obligations Compliance with a legal obligation — Article 6(1)(c) GDPR
Maintaining website security, preventing fraud and establishing or defending legal claims Legitimate interests — Article 6(1)(f) GDPR
Answering general enquiries unrelated to an existing or proposed contract Legitimate interests in responding to enquiries — Article 6(1)(f) GDPR
Processing a delivery recipient’s details supplied by the purchaser Legitimate interests in fulfilling the purchaser’s delivery instructions — Article 6(1)(f) GDPR
Sending optional newsletters and using optional analytics or advertising technologies Consent — Article 6(1)(a) GDPR

Where we rely on legitimate interests, we consider the impact on your rights and reasonable expectations.

We need certain contact, delivery and payment information to fulfil an order. Without that information, we may be unable to complete your purchase. Providing information for optional marketing is voluntary.

8. Cookies, analytics and advertising

Our website uses cookies and similar technologies.

Strictly necessary technologies support functions such as the shopping cart, checkout, security and the storage of your privacy choices. Where the legal conditions are met, these technologies do not require consent under Section 25(2) TDDDG.

Optional analytics and advertising technologies require your prior consent. These may measure website use, assess advertising performance or support personalised advertising. Their use is based on Section 25(1) TDDDG and, where personal data is processed on the basis of consent, Article 6(1)(a) GDPR. See Section 25 TDDDG.

You can review or change your choices through the Cookie settings / Cookie-Einstellungen link on our website. Withdrawing consent does not affect processing that was lawful before withdrawal.

11. How long we retain personal data

We retain personal data for the purposes described in this policy and for applicable legal retention periods.

  • Accounting and tax records: where German statutory retention obligations apply, accounting vouchers are generally retained for eight years, relevant business correspondence for six years, and books and certain accounting records for ten years. The periods generally begin at the end of the relevant calendar year and may be extended where legally required. See Section 147 of the German Fiscal Code.
  • Order and support information: retained for fulfilment, handling returns or complaints, and any necessary period for legal obligations or claims.
  • Customer accounts: retained while needed to provide the account. Closing an account does not remove records we must retain separately.
  • Personalisation files: retained only for production, related support and any justified legal or contractual retention needs.
  • Marketing information: retained until you unsubscribe or the purpose ends. Limited consent records or suppression information may remain where necessary to demonstrate compliance and respect your preferences.
  • Technical logs and tracking information: retained according to their security or service purpose and the applicable provider settings. Service-specific retention periods must be stated in the relevant disclosures.

When retention is no longer justified, personal data is deleted or anonymised.

12. Your rights

Subject to the applicable legal conditions, you may request access to your personal data, correction, erasure, restriction of processing and data portability. You may also withdraw consent at any time.

You may object to processing based on legitimate interests on grounds relating to your particular situation. We will stop unless we demonstrate overriding compelling grounds or need the data for legal claims.

You may object to direct marketing, including related profiling, at any time. We will stop processing your data for that purpose.

To exercise your rights, contact kontakt@rk-store.de. We generally respond within one month. For complex or numerous requests, we may extend this by up to two further months and explain the extension within the first month. Proportionate identity verification may be necessary. Requests are generally free of charge.

You also have the right to complain to a supervisory authority, particularly in the EU/EEA country where you live, work or believe an infringement occurred.

Further information is available from the European Data Protection Board.
